
Last updated 03-31-2026
Category:
Reviews:
Join thousands of AI enthusiasts in the World of AI!
FinSignals
FinSignals offers a specialized API designed to analyze financial social media content and news in real time. It processes text from sources like Reddit posts and financial news, delivering sentiment and other key classifications across seven distinct categories in a single API call. This makes it a practical tool for developers and businesses who need to extract meaningful financial signals from large volumes of social data quickly and efficiently.
The API is built for developers who integrate financial data into their applications, providing a structured and fast alternative to general-purpose language models. FinSignals stands out by offering seven classification outputs simultaneously, including sentiment, directionality, content quality, post type, relevance to ticker symbols, author confidence, and a sarcasm flag. This comprehensive approach helps users filter out noise and focus on actionable insights.
One of the key advantages is its speed and cost-effectiveness. FinSignals processes requests with latencies between 5 to 15 milliseconds and is significantly cheaper—6 to 30 times less costly—than large language models like GPT-4o. It supports batch processing of up to 256 posts per call, offering a 30% credit discount for bulk classification, which is ideal for high-volume use cases.
Technically, the API requires an API key for authentication and supports both single and batch classification endpoints. It returns structured JSON responses with detailed classification results and probabilities. The sarcasm detection feature is experimental and intended to help identify ironic or sarcastic posts that might invert literal sentiment. The service is designed to be easy to integrate, requiring no SDK and supporting simple HTTP POST requests.
FinSignals also supports flexible data sourcing. Users can fetch Reddit posts using the official PRAW Python wrapper or opt for third-party data providers for large-scale data collection. This flexibility allows users to build fully automated pipelines combining data collection and classification.
The pricing model is credit-based with a free tier offering 1,000 credits per month and paid plans scaling with usage. Credits are consumed per API call, with batch requests offering cost savings. There are no hidden fees, and users can cancel anytime without penalties. The platform emphasizes transparency with no silent overages and provides usage monitoring through its dashboard.
Overall, FinSignals is a focused tool for developers and businesses needing fast, affordable, and reliable financial sentiment analysis from social media and news content, especially suited for those processing large volumes of data.
⚡ Fast classification with 5-15 ms latency for quick results
📊 Seven simultaneous sentiment and signal outputs in one call
💰 Cost-effective pricing, 6-30× cheaper than large language models
📦 Batch processing up to 256 posts with 30% credit discount
🔑 Easy integration with simple HTTP POST, no SDK required
Delivers seven financial sentiment signals in a single API call
Significantly faster and cheaper than general-purpose LLMs
Supports batch processing with cost savings for high volume
Free tier with 1,000 credits and no credit card required
Simple authentication and easy setup with no SDK needed
Sarcasm detection is experimental and may require validation
Rate limits apply, which may affect very high-frequency users
Requires external data sourcing for text input, not included
How does FinSignals handle batch processing and pricing?
Batch requests charge 1 credit for the first item plus 0.7 credits for each additional item in the same call, offering cost savings over single requests.
What classification signals does FinSignals provide in each API call?
Each call returns seven signals: sentiment, directionality, content quality, post type, relevance to ticker, author confidence, and a sarcasm flag.
Can I use FinSignals without providing my own data source?
FinSignals classifies text you send it; you need to supply the text, typically from Reddit via PRAW or third-party data providers.
Is there a free tier to try FinSignals before committing?
Yes, the free tier offers 1,000 credits per month with full access to all endpoints and no credit card required.
What is the latency for classification requests?
FinSignals processes requests with latencies typically between 5 to 15 milliseconds.
How does FinSignals compare to using GPT-4o for financial sentiment analysis?
FinSignals is 6 to 30 times cheaper and about 20 times faster, with no need for prompt engineering or handling malformed JSON.
What should I know about the sarcasm detection feature?
The sarcasm flag is experimental and should be used as a directional indicator until validated on your own data.
